Prior to receiving my tea, peppermint capsules, and fiber.. I noticed that organic peppermint teas were wreaking havoc on my stomach..should I expect the same w/ Heather's products? Just a little peppermint aftertaste this morning w/ use of the peppermint capsule.. but no stomach upset yet..Any comments would be appreciated. Thank you!

Hi - if you're at all prone to heartburn or GERD, peppermint can be tricky. It's great for relaxing the gut, and that has lots of benefits for the lower GI, but relaxing the upper GI and the esophageal sphincter can then allow acid reflux if you're susceptible to that.

Some people prone to heartburn can tolerate peppermint tea, which is not as strong as the peppermint oil caps. But other people do better with the peppermint caps, because they are enteric coated to pass through the stomach and not dissolve until they reach the intestines. And some people just can't do peppermint at all.

I think this is really trial and error as it varies so much from person to person. Sorry that is not more specifically helpful.
